Output 3400a3780e4c3d2c4e155de7f516a0465aa2e4d3a75e2bbcec84dcb3c9795153:0

value
626000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 774493075bbff74caadcd882247886c0120a9b2c OP_EQUAL
address
3CZeUzvz9omB6YZshRqMWnBGuMUhmgHGFc
transaction
3400a3780e4c3d2c4e155de7f516a0465aa2e4d3a75e2bbcec84dcb3c9795153
confirmations
361516
spent
true